Transaction 5c578e5788017d496163ac5df5607a5f140f580b89ed445184430f027e903eb6

5 Input
2 Outputs
  • 5c578e5788017d496163ac5df5607a5f140f580b89ed445184430f027e903eb6:0
  • value  994680
    address  3CBjhfbdYJaszQpobFLhLeXr4rb51MrPeA
  • 5c578e5788017d496163ac5df5607a5f140f580b89ed445184430f027e903eb6:1
  • value  248900
    address  15Co856cRnFRCKwSSzECoyT3ozVhuFoJZ6